Our Treatment Options Include:

  • Chemotherapy
    We administer a broad range of chemotherapy regimens for various types of cancer. Our experienced oncology team provides careful monitoring and symptom management, working to minimize side effects and preserve quality of life throughout your treatment journey.
  • Immunotherapy
    As one of the most innovative developments in cancer care, immunotherapy helps harness the body’s own immune system to fight cancer cells. We offer the most recent standards of care and help patients understand if they are a candidate for these targeted treatments.
  • IVIG (Intravenous Immunoglobulin) Therapy
    IVIG therapy is used to treat a variety of autoimmune and immune deficiency disorders. Our infusion center provides IVIG infusions under the supervision of our hematology team, with personalized dosing and monitoring based on your specific diagnosis.
  • Osteoporosis Treatment
    Patients with osteoporosis or low bone density may benefit from injectable or intravenous therapies to help preserve or improve bone strength and reduce fracture risk. These treatments are often part of care plans for patients with cancer, chronic illness, or aging-related concerns.
  • Anemia Injections for Chronic Kidney Disease
    Anemia is a common complication of chronic kidney disease. We offer erythropoiesis-stimulating agents (such as EPO or darbepoetin) and iron support to manage hemoglobin levels and reduce the burden of fatigue.
